Electronics nearby 87 Cassio Road, Watford WD18 0QN, United Kingdom

Thyron Systems Ltd

Approximately 1.51 km away
Address: Saint Andrews, The Belfry Colonial Way, Watford, Hertfordshire WD24 4WH, United Kingdom

Provisual

Approximately 1.65 km away
Address: Blueprint Commercial Centre/Imperial Way, Watford WD24 4JP, United Kingdom

Storm Technologies Limited

Approximately 1.84 km away
Address: The Boulevard, Blackmoor Lane, Croxley Business Park, Watford, Hertfordshire WD18 8YW, United Kingdom

Mayflower Protection Solutions

Approximately 1.87 km away
Address: 44 Aldenham Road, Bushey WD23 2NA, United Kingdom